SUMMARY

The correct placement of an object in relation to a magnifying glass, specifically a convex lens, is crucial for creating a virtual image. The object must be positioned between the lens and its focal point (F). This placement allows the magnifying glass to produce an enlarged virtual image that can be viewed comfortably.

I am having trouble trying to work out where an object should be placed with regards to a magnifying glass.

Should it be located between the lens and the focal point F to create a virtual image?

many thanks?

Yes you are correct Ghostbuster25 the object should be placed in between the convex lens and its focal point.
